2. Electric Vehicles: The Transportation Revolution
The electric vehicle (EV) market is booming, with sales expected to reach 14.8 million units by 2027. As governments worldwide impose stricter emissions regulations, EVs are becoming increasingly attractive to consumers. Companies like Tesla, Rivian, and Lucid Motors are leading the charge, with advancements in battery technology, range, and affordability making EVs a viable alternative to traditional fossil-fuel vehicles.

3. Smart Buildings and Cities: Efficiency and Sustainability
The built environment accounts for nearly 40% of global energy consumption, making smart buildings and cities a critical area of focus. Technologies like IoT sensors, energy harvesting, and green roofs are transforming the way we design and operate buildings, reducing energy consumption and waste. Cities like Singapore and Barcelona are pioneering smart city initiatives, showcasing the potential for sustainable urban development.

4. Biodegradable Materials: The Future of Packaging
The packaging industry is one of the largest contributors to waste and plastic pollution. Biodegradable materials, such as plant-based plastics and bioplastics, are offering a sustainable alternative. Companies like Ecovative and LanzaTech are developing innovative materials that can replace traditional plastics, reducing waste and promoting a more circular economy.

5. Artificial Intelligence for Sustainability: The Unseen Champion
Artificial intelligence (AI) is often associated with efficiency and cost savings, but its applications in sustainability are vast. AI can optimize energy consumption, predict and prevent natural disasters, and even detect environmental pollutants. Companies like Google and Microsoft are already leveraging AI to drive sustainability initiatives, and its potential is only beginning to be tapped.
